人胃癌细胞原位移植转移裸鼠原发灶及转移灶中锌指蛋白139的表达及其与肿瘤侵袭转移的关系研究 被引量:5

Expression of ZNF139 and Its Relationship with Invasion and Metastasis in Primay Tumors and Metastases of Orthotopic Implantation Nude Mice

摘要 目的观察人胃癌细胞原位移植转移裸鼠模型原发灶及转移灶中锌指蛋白139(ZNF139)的表达,探讨其与肿瘤侵袭转移的关系。方法建立人胃癌细胞株SGC7901原位移植转移裸鼠模型,采用逆转录-聚合酶链反应、免疫组织化学S-P法检测ZNF139、基质金属蛋白酶-2(MMP-2)、基质金属蛋白酶-7(MMP-7)在原发灶、肝转移灶、脾转移灶、腹膜种植转移灶、转移淋巴结中的表达情况。结果人胃癌细胞原位移植转移裸鼠模型成瘤率为93.3%(28/30),其中75.0%(21/28)发生肝转移、67.9%(19/28)发生脾转移、85.7%(24/28)发生腹膜种植转移、39.3%(11/28)发生淋巴结转移。ZNF139、MMP-2、MMP-7在肝转移灶、腹膜种植转移灶及转移淋巴结中mRNA表达水平和蛋白表达阳性率均高于原发灶(P<0.05),原发灶、各转移灶中ZNF139 mRNA与MMP-2 mR-NA、MMP-7 mRNA的表达均呈正相关(P<0.05)。结论人胃癌细胞原位移植转移裸鼠模型可很好地模拟胃癌在人体内的侵袭、转移过程。与原发灶比较,转移灶中肿瘤细胞具有更强的侵袭能力,可能与转移过程中ZNF139促进MMP-2、MMP-7的表达有关。 Objective To investigate the expression of zinc finger protein 139 (ZNF139) and its relationship with in- vasion and metastasis in the primary tumor and metastases of orthotopic implantation nude mice. Methods Orthotopic implanta- tion nude mice with human gastric carcinoma cells were established. Then reverse transcription - polymerase chain reaction (RT- PCR) and immunohistochemical method (S -P) were used to detect the expression of ZNF139, MMP- 2 and MMP- 7 in orthotopic transplantation tumor, liver metastases, spleen metastasis, peritoneal metastasis and lymph node metasta- sis. Results The tumor formation rate was 93.3% (28/30), and hepatic metastases were 75.0% (21/28), spleen metastases were 67. 9% (19/28), peritoneal metastases were 85.7% (24/28) and lymph node metastases were 39. 3% (11/28) . The mRNA expression and protein positive expression rate of ZNF139, MMP - 2 and MMP - 7 in liver metastases, peritoneal metasta- ses and lymph node metastases were significantly higher than in primary tumor ( P 〈 0.05 ) . The expression of ZNF139 mRNA was positively correlated with the expression of MMP - 2 mRNA and MMP - 7 mRNA both in primary tumor and metastases (P 〈 O. 05). Conclusion Models of orthotopic implantation nude mice can well simulate the invasion and transfer process. Invasion and metastasis are stronger in metastases than in primary tumor, and ZNF139 may be involved in this process by promoting the ex- pression of MMP -2 and MMP -7.
